DOT physical exams are thorough check-ups required by the Department of Transportation for commercial vehicle drivers. These evaluations confirm drivers' physical, mental, and emotional capacity to safely handle hefty vehicles on public highways. Conducted by a Certified Medical Examiner from the National Registry, passing grants a DOT medical certificate, necessary for a valid CDL per FMCSA rules. What is checked in a DOT Physical?
- Health history review and medication assessment
- Vision screening (corrective lenses allowed; minimum standards apply)
- Hearing assessment (forced whisper or audiometry)
- Blood pressure and pulse rate
- Physical examination (systems review)
- Urinalysis (specific gravity, protein, glucose)

Who needs a DOT Physical?
You need a valid DOT medical card if:
- Holding a commercial driver's license (CDL) - class A, B, or C for operating across states
- Driving vehicles over 10,001 lbs. GVWR interstate
- Transporting over 8 passengers (for hire) or more than 15 (not for hire)
- Handling hazardous materials requiring placards as per DOT standards

What Will Fail a DOT Physical?
Medical Conditions That Can Fail a DOT Physical
- Vision & Hearing: Vision less than 20/40 (with aid), trouble identifying signal colors, or hearing deficiency for a whisper at 5 feet hinder driving.
- Blood Pressure & Heart Disease: High blood pressure (≥180/110 mmHg), recent cardiovascular events, or implanted devices may disqualify.
- Diabetes: Unmanaged diabetes with frequent hypo events or complications like neuropathy may affect driving ability.
- Sleep Apnea & Respiratory Issues: Untreated conditions causing drowsiness or severe lung impairments could disqualify.
- Neurological Disorders: Seizure disorders or conditions causing unconsciousness affect eligibility unless exempted.
- Substance Abuse: Current illegal substances, alcohol dependency, or misuse of meds compromise safe driving.
- Psychiatric & Cognitive Disorders: Severe mental illness or cognitive decline that affects decision-making may result in disqualification.
Temporary vs. Permanent Disqualification: Some medical issues may result in a temporary ban until cleared by a physician. Others, like untreated seizure disorders, usually lead to permanent disqualification as per FMCSA standards.
